首頁  >  問答  >  主體

python for迴圈中的函數只能運行一次?

雷雷
伊谢尔伦伊谢尔伦2690 天前986

全部回覆(2)我來回復

  • 習慣沉默

    習慣沉默2017-06-30 09:57:41

    我估計是run裡面最後的itchat.run()使得itchat服務被掛起了,由於掛起服務,所以第一次調用run()的時候無法跳出,導致後面幾次for無法繼續運作。

    回覆
    0
  • 高洛峰

    高洛峰2017-06-30 09:57:41

    itchat.run會掛起,把itchat.autologin和itchat.run提到外面來,然後起個子執行緒來運行你自己的run函數,不過itchar.run必須放到子執行緒啟動之後

    回覆
    0
  • 取消回覆